I have a question is that I cancel the flink task and retain the
checkpoint dir, then restore from the checkpoint dir ,can I change the
flink operator's parallelism,in my thoughts, I think I can't change the
flink operator's parallelism,but I am not sure.
Thanks to your rep
I think you can modify the operator’s parallelism. It is only if you have
set maxParallelism, and while restoring from a checkpoint, you shouldn’t
modify the maxParallelism. Otherwise, I believe the state will be lost.

Hi,
Yes, you can change the parallelism. One thing that you can not change is “max
parallelism”.

If you want to change the max parallelism then you need to take a savepoint
and use Flink's state processor API [1] to rewrite the max parallelism by
creating a new savepoint from the old one.
